2008 Howard Park Sauvignon Blanc

Short Tasting Notes

The wine is a very pale straw/green. It exhibits a wonderfully fragrant nose of snow peas, guava and dried sage with a little passionfruit. Juicy and tight with citrus acidity, the palate has herbal and grassy notes with some weight showing from the barrel fermented component. Finishing with typical crisp acidity and great fruit length the Howard Park 2008 Sauvignon Blanc is bright and fruit driven.
